Course structure

• Introduction to Food Justice • Global Food Systems Analysis • Food Policy and Advocacy • Sustainable Agriculture Practices • Food Sovereignty Movements • Community Organizing for Food Equity • Food Waste Reduction Strategies • Nutrition Education and Public Health • Food Activism Campaign Planning
